Correlative Imaging Platform Linking Taste Cell Function to Molecular Identity
A correlative imaging platform is developed to study how individual taste cells respond to different taste qualities. By linking cellular activity with molecular identity and environmental context, dual‐tuned taste cells capable of detecting both sweet and umami stimuli are identified.

Visualization of proportions is a very common need and there are many techniques for it. The pie chart is popular among practitioners and general audience, but many prominent experts advise against using it. This paper reports an experiment where the pie chart is compared to stacked bar charts with a baseline condition of table.
